> Fix CVE-2020-13253
>
> By using invalidated address, guest can do out-of-bounds accesses.
> These patches fix the issue by only allowing SD card image sizes
> power of 2, and not switching to SEND_DATA state when the address
> is invalid (out of range).
>
> This issue was found using QEMU fuzzing mode (using --enable-fuzzing,
> see docs/devel/fuzzing.txt) and reported by Alexander Bulekov.
